Rishi Sunak joins Oxford, Stanford in academic roles

Rishi Sunak joins Oxford, Stanford in academic roles

Rediff.com23 Jan 2025

Former UK Prime Minister Rishi Sunak has taken on new academic roles at the University of Oxford and Stanford University, both alma maters of the Conservative Party member of Parliament. Sunak will join Oxford's Blavatnik School of Government as a member of the World Leaders Circle and a Distinguished Fellow, while at Stanford, he will be the William C Edwards Distinguished Visiting Fellow at the Hoover Institution. Sunak expressed his enthusiasm for contributing to both institutions, highlighting their leading research in global challenges, economic policy, and technological advancements. He emphasized the significance of his education at both universities in shaping his life and career. The appointments have been welcomed by both institutions, with leaders praising Sunak's expertise and experience in global affairs and economic policy.

Nothing wrong in Murty selling shares: Govt

Nothing wrong in Murty selling shares: Govt

Rediff.com6 Feb 2009

"What's wrong in that? Even if you have shares, you will sell them," Corporate Affairs Minister Prem Chand Gupta told reporters in New Delhi. The minister was replying to a query as to whether the fact that Murty sold the shares between December 12-16, 2008, was a matter of concern and could have been a case of insider trading as the sale preceded an abortive acquisition deal -- now at the centre of the accounting scam in Satyam.
